Training Industrial Robots in metys the Industrial Metaverse Plattform– From Simulation to Shopfloor
Autonomous robotics in industry does not start on the shopfloor — it starts in simulation.
In this session, we present how industrial robots can be trained, validated, and optimized within a scalable simulation environment using metys, EDAG’s industrial execution framework.
The focus lies on:
- physics-based simulation
- process-aware robot training
- collision and path validation
- integration of real production constraints
Rather than discussing autonomy in theory, this talk demonstrates how simulation environments can accelerate commissioning, reduce ramp-up risk, and improve reliability before physical deployment.
We will show how virtual robot training becomes a practical industrial tool — bridging digital validation and real-world production execution.
Key Takeaways:
- How simulation reduces commissioning risk in robotics projects
- Why production context is critical for robot training
- How digital twins enable safer and faster ramp-up
- Practical insights from industrial use cases
